This share is going to be a cash-cow. Research has shown that a spin-off outperforms the market in the (2-3 year) period immediately after the spin off.

The spin-off often does better than the parent company, see below:

http://www.investopedia....arents-and-spinoffs.asp

IMO to maximise returns, the options are:

1. Sell the company just before the de-merger then buy into the insurance business after de-merger.

2. Await the de-merger, sell the parent (bank), keep the insurance.
